Fairfax: the Renaissance.

Australasian Business Intelligence, December, 2006

Byline: Pamela Williams

Dec 10, 2006 (The Australian Financial Review - ABIX via COMTEX) -- The Fairfax family is poised to come back to the newspaper company it used to own. John B Fairfax, of Rural Press, is poised to enter a $A3 billion merger with the company his family started, John Fairfax Holdings. The group will be renamed Fairfax Media in early 2007. It is 19 years since John B Fairfax was ousted from John Fairfax by a family coup. The saga is a long one, full of twists and turns for the Fairfax family. John B Fairfax is keen to see the family newspaper keep its powerful role as guardian of the public's right to know, to keep politicians honest.
